#2c2f04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c2f04 is composed of 17.3% red, 18.4%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.5%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 64.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 10%. #2c2f04 color hex could be obtained by blending #585e08 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#2c2f04 color description : Very dark (mostly black) yellow [Olive tone].
#2c2f04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c2f04 has RGB values of R:44, G:47,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2895620.

Shades and Tints of #2c2f04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0b01 is the darkest color, while #fefef8 is the lightest one.
